Key Battles Report
This analytical history worksheet supports students in Grades 4, 5, and 6 as they investigate major turning points of the American Revolution through structured research and reporting. By acting as “junior field historians,” learners examine the Battles of Lexington & Concord, Saratoga, and Yorktown while practicing factual recall, concise summarization, informational writing, and understanding of how military decisions influenced the outcome of the war.
